A gauge of Chinese stocks in Hong Kong edged toward a bear market as trading resumed after a holiday, weighed down by weak consumption data.
The Hang Seng China Enterprises Index dropped as much as 2.2%, taking its decline to nearly 20% from its Oct. 2 high. Alibaba Group Holding Ltd. and Xiaomi Corp. were among the biggest drags on the gauge.
